Liana's Summary: Aria Rose has been told that she overdosed on Stic, causing herself to lose her memories. The choices she makes can save or doom the city-including herself. Only when Aria meets Hunter, a gorgeous rebel mystic from the Depths, does she start to have glimmers of recollection-and to understand that he holds the key to unlocking her past. And she can't conceive why her parents would have agreed to unite with the Fosters in the first place. But Aria doesn't remember falling in love with Thomas in fact, she wakes one day with huge gaps in her memory. The union of the two will end the generations-long political feud-and unite all those living in the Aeries, the privileged upper reaches of the city, against the banished mystics who dwell below in the Depths. Book Summary: Aria Rose, youngest scion of one of Mystic City's two ruling rival families, finds herself betrothed to Thomas Foster, the son of her parents' sworn enemies.
